Hong Kong Unveils Plans for Affordable Passenger Drones

- Hong Kong plans to introduce passenger-carrying drones within two to three years to boost its low-altitude economy.
- Dominic Chow Wing-hang, deputy director general of civil aviation, announced the plan in Beijing.
- The drones are expected to be more affordable than helicopter services.
- The sandbox program will test aircraft and electric vertical take-off and landing vehicles (eVTOLs), validate safety standards, and enable trials on air routes to connect with mainland China.
